BJP central co-observer urges TMC govt to check violence

Press Trust of India Kolkata
BJP's central co-observer for West Bengal Sidharth Nath Singh today said that the Mamata Banerjee government must check the pre-panchayat poll violence and take help of the Central security forces in this regard.

Alleging that the state government had violated all democratic norms over the holding of the panchayat poll, Singh said that over nine political deaths, including that of a BJP candidate, had taken place.

Noting that free and fair elections are the essence of any democracy, the BJP leader said that though law and order is the state subject, "hooliganism and terrorism of TMC and Left cadres" had been creating panic in Bengal villages.
 

"This must be checked by the TMC government, and if required, by taking the help of the Central security forces," he said.
